茶原产于中国西南地区,中国人饮茶的历史已经有数千年,茶丰富并滋润着中国人的生活,也形成了独特而深厚的中国茶文化。中国已经有两千多年的茶树栽培史,茶独有的醇美滋味使其超越饮食与文化的差异,成为东西方有口皆碑的饮品。茶马古道、古代丝绸之路、草原茶叶之路、海上丝绸之路。从唐朝开始,中国茶叶就已经成为世界贸易的重要商品,所到之处形成了不同的饮茶习俗和茶文化形态。18世纪以后,中国茶树在印度、斯里兰卡等地种植成功。迄今为止,全世界种茶国家已达六十多个,170多个国家和地区的二十多亿人钟情于饮茶。
